What is the role of frame rate in 3D model optimization for games?

Frame rate is a critical performance benchmark in 3D model optimization for games, directly balancing visual detail and real-time rendering smoothness. It measures how many frames (images) the game displays per second (FPS). Optimizing 3D models—such as reducing polygon counts, simplifying textures, or using LOD (Level of Detail) techniques—aims to maintain or boost target FPS without losing visual appeal. When frame rates drop, overly complex models are often the culprit; optimizing them ensures stable, smooth gameplay, making frame rate the core driver of 3D model optimization in games.
